In exchange for childcare and light housework, an au pair is given a place to stay, food to eat, and some pocket money. Currently, the minimum is $195.75 per week. Au pairs also work fewer hours than nannies. For instance, they can work a maximum of 10 hours per day and 45 hours per week but are entitled to one and a half days off each week.

Families living in the state of Massachusetts and California are required to follow local labor laws while hosting an au pair, including the requirement to pay local minimum wage. An experienced nanny can cost between $350 and $700 a week, plus employer’s tax, social security tax and health insurance. If you decide to sponsor an au pair instead, the costs include a weekly stipend, as well as all of the placement and travel expenses. An au pair can cost about $140 a week, plus $5,000 to $6,000 in expenses.
An au pair ( / oʊˈpɛər /; pl.: au pairs) is a helper from a foreign country working for, and living as part of, a host family. Typically, au pairs take on a share of the family's responsibility for child care as well as some housework, and receive a monetary allowance or stipend for personal use.
